Instructions to make Fried Corn on the Cobb:
- Shuck your corn and heat your oil..
- Fry in the oil rolling as needed..
- This will snap, crackle, and pop so be careful..
- When you have the corn caramelized a bit and it good and Fried remove from the oil. Add salt to taste, I hope you enjoy!!! Add butter to taste if you like..

Let them cool just a bit… Now is a good time to sprinkle them with your favorite Corn on the cob toppings… Skillet-fried corn is a Southern favorite and is a go-to recipe when corn on the cob is at its peak. This recipe is different from creamed corn, another popular dish from down South, in that it does not include any milk or flour. Instead, this savory side dish boasts bacon drippings, a nice counterpoint to the to sweet corn.
